    D3 water pump

    Hi guys , I am about to replace my timing belt along with all the usual suspect parts. Next year we are starting a 2 year around aus going remote as possible. Would it be wise to replace the water pump at the same time ? I think I know the answer but haven't seen problems with them pop up much.
    Cheers
    Lucas

    Mine was done at this time on basis it was easy and small relative extra cost. Do the plastic hose block piece also.

    The water pump is not hard, can be done easy enough , depends on how many ks you have .

    Your call really but let sleeping dogs lie I say- unless you have lots of ks or your coolant is old and suspect.

    Have you got the locking kit for the timing gear.

    Cheers Ean
